.elementor-3059 .elementor-element.elementor-element-f1f805b{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-widget-hotspot .widget-image-caption{color:var( --e-global-color-text );font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);}.elementor-widget-hotspot{--hotspot-color:var( --e-global-color-primary );--hotspot-box-color:var( --e-global-color-secondary );--tooltip-color:var( --e-global-color-secondary );}.elementor-widget-hotspot .e-hotspot__label{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);}.elementor-widget-hotspot .e-hotspot__tooltip{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-3059 .elementor-element.elementor-element-a0ff4f8 .elementor-repeater-item-7973713{left:99%;--hotspot-translate-x:99%;top:1%;--hotspot-translate-y:1%;}.elementor-3059 .elementor-element.elementor-element-a0ff4f8 .elementor-repeater-item-ee69e2c{left:99%;--hotspot-translate-x:99%;top:5%;--hotspot-translate-y:5%;}.elementor-3059 .elementor-element.elementor-element-a0ff4f8 .elementor-repeater-item-a69bdd0{--hotspot-min-width:146px;--hotspot-min-height:169px;left:65%;--hotspot-translate-x:65%;top:49%;--hotspot-translate-y:49%;}.elementor-3059 .elementor-element.elementor-element-a0ff4f8 .elementor-repeater-item-fb1f7bb{--hotspot-min-width:146px;--hotspot-min-height:169px;left:68%;--hotspot-translate-x:68%;top:49%;--hotspot-translate-y:49%;}.elementor-3059 .elementor-element.elementor-element-a0ff4f8 .elementor-repeater-item-bae5689{--hotspot-min-width:146px;--hotspot-min-height:169px;left:71%;--hotspot-translate-x:71%;top:49%;--hotspot-translate-y:49%;}.elementor-3059 .elementor-element.elementor-element-a0ff4f8 .elementor-repeater-item-eacdec5{--hotspot-min-width:146px;--hotspot-min-height:169px;left:65%;--hotspot-translate-x:65%;top:49%;--hotspot-translate-y:49%;}.elementor-3059 .elementor-element.elementor-element-a0ff4f8 .elementor-repeater-item-3c21b41{--hotspot-min-width:146px;--hotspot-min-height:169px;left:65%;--hotspot-translate-x:65%;top:49%;--hotspot-translate-y:49%;}.elementor-3059 .elementor-element.elementor-element-a0ff4f8 .elementor-repeater-item-61e55c2{--hotspot-min-width:146px;--hotspot-min-height:169px;left:74%;--hotspot-translate-x:74%;top:49%;--hotspot-translate-y:49%;}.elementor-3059 .elementor-element.elementor-element-a0ff4f8 .elementor-repeater-item-ac121af{--hotspot-min-width:146px;--hotspot-min-height:169px;left:77%;--hotspot-translate-x:77%;top:49%;--hotspot-translate-y:49%;}.elementor-3059 .elementor-element.elementor-element-a0ff4f8 .elementor-repeater-item-a183778{--hotspot-min-width:146px;--hotspot-min-height:169px;left:80%;--hotspot-translate-x:80%;top:49%;--hotspot-translate-y:49%;}.elementor-3059 .elementor-element.elementor-element-a0ff4f8 .elementor-repeater-item-3a02af4{--hotspot-min-width:146px;--hotspot-min-height:169px;left:83%;--hotspot-translate-x:83%;top:49%;--hotspot-translate-y:49%;}.elementor-3059 .elementor-element.elementor-element-a0ff4f8 .elementor-repeater-item-d497ea7{--hotspot-min-width:146px;--hotspot-min-height:169px;left:86%;--hotspot-translate-x:86%;top:49%;--hotspot-translate-y:49%;}.elementor-3059 .elementor-element.elementor-element-a0ff4f8 .elementor-repeater-item-10367b2{--hotspot-min-width:146px;--hotspot-min-height:169px;left:88%;--hotspot-translate-x:88%;top:40%;--hotspot-translate-y:40%;}.elementor-3059 .elementor-element.elementor-element-a0ff4f8 .e-hotspot--tooltip-position{right:initial;bottom:initial;left:initial;top:calc(100% + 5px );}.elementor-3059 .elementor-element.elementor-element-a0ff4f8{--container-max-width:100%;--hotspot-color:#6EC1E400;--hotspot-size:31px;--hotspot-min-width:84px;--hotspot-min-height:326px;--hotspot-padding:2px;}.elementor-3059 .elementor-element.elementor-element-a0ff4f8 .e-hotspot__label{font-family:"Lato", Sans-serif;font-weight:600;}/* Start Custom Fonts CSS */@font-face {
	font-family: 'Lato';
	font-style: normal;
	font-weight: 400;
	font-display: auto;
	src: url('/wp-content/uploads/2024/10/Lato-Regular.ttf') format('truetype');
}
@font-face {
	font-family: 'Lato';
	font-style: normal;
	font-weight: 500;
	font-display: auto;
	src: url('/wp-content/uploads/2024/10/Lato-Bold.ttf') format('truetype');
}
@font-face {
	font-family: 'Lato';
	font-style: normal;
	font-weight: 600;
	font-display: auto;
	src: url('/wp-content/uploads/2024/10/Lato-Black.ttf') format('truetype');
}
@font-face {
	font-family: 'Lato';
	font-style: normal;
	font-weight: 300;
	font-display: auto;
	src: url('/wp-content/uploads/2024/10/Lato-Light.ttf') format('truetype');
}
@font-face {
	font-family: 'Lato';
	font-style: normal;
	font-weight: 200;
	font-display: auto;
	src: url('/wp-content/uploads/2024/10/Lato-Thin.ttf') format('truetype');
}
/* End Custom Fonts CSS */